以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  [求助]这段交易指令为什么不会立即反手?  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=2589)

--  作者:jinze
--  发布时间:2010/8/24 9:58:05
--  [求助]这段交易指令为什么不会立即反手?

if tholding<>0 then
 begin
 //平多
 TSELL(skcon or endtime,1,lmt,l),ORDERQUEUE;
 
 //平空

 TSELLSHORT(bkcon or endtime ,1,lmt,h),ORDERQUEUE; 
 
 end

if tholding=0 then
 begin
 
 
 //开空
 TBUYSHORT(timecon and skcon,1,lmt,l),ORDERQUEUE;
 
 //开多

 TBUY(timecon and bkcon,1,lmt,h),ORDERQUEUE;
 end


--  作者:jinze
--  发布时间:2010/8/24 10:06:22
--  
每次平仓后,都要等下个周期有满足条件的再开仓,不会在本周期开仓。我的开平条件是一样的,按道理平仓后要立即开仓的。因为平仓后持仓已经为0了。
--  作者:fly
--  发布时间:2010/8/24 11:08:46
--  

平仓指令发出后,交易柜台不一定立马成交,THOLDING不一定立马变成0,建议增加SLEEP函数,给适当时间使平仓指令成交

http://www.weistock.com/bbs/dispbbs.asp?boardid=16&Id=332

祥看问题15

[此贴子已经被作者于2013/8/27 10:22:24编辑过]